About Amitava
I write and edit books. I am also an artist, cartoonist and documentary film-maker. I have taught underprivileged children for some time as well as adults who for various reasons missed an opportunity to learn English 'properly'. I was part of the team that in 1999 started designing a new kind of textbooks for primary students in West Bengal - it was a WB Government project being funded by the DFID. I am passionate about literature and arts, kids are naturally drawn to me, and I cook to relax. I have a cat.

Techniques largely depend on individual students. For school students, making them stay attentive is a challenge, and therefore I use a lot of visual elements and make learning an experience which is basically fun. This is especially useful while teaching grammar. College students and adults like my approach of using film scripts a lot - an interaction between Cary Grant and Ingrid Bergman is always more exciting than a dreary everyday text. But some students like to stick to the straight and the narrow, and for them I am always more conservative. I do assign 'home-works', but that is never a lengthy piece of drudgery, but more like listening to audio books which are easily accessible these days. I have taught Visual Anthropology to Bangladeshi students at the Asian Institute of Photography, and I know how to handle first generation learners without being condescending.
